Two more cellars are found in hostel

0544665.jpgTWO more cellars and more items of significance have been unearthed at former children’s home, Haut de la Garenne.

Work resumed at the site yesterday, with the team establishing that there were a third and fourth cellar beneath the Jersey home. However, to protect the integrity of forensics, only when the team has finished working in cellars one and two will an exploration begin of rooms three and four.

Commenting on work so far, senior investigating officer Lenny Harper said that police had received evidence from another victim over the last few days which told of abuse in one of these two new rooms.  Room three, he said, was very like room two, while room four was similar in dimensions but might have less headroom.

‘Items have been recovered from cellar rooms one and two which tend to corroborate the statements of victims,’ said Mr Harper. ‘These could well be of forensic significance. We are not saying what these are, not because we want to be secretive, but because if the victims or witnesses mention them they lose evidential value if details are published.’

Away from Haut de la Garenne, the historic child abuse inquiry team is said to be continuing work and interviewing victims and witnesses.

Police said yesterday that more information had been received about the abuse that went on in the cellar.

‘We do not know about the carbon dating yet of the skull fragment yet,’ Mr Harper added.

‘More-sensitive tests will be carried out.

‘All we can say at the moment is that the skull fragment was placed in the location no earlier than the 1920s.’

The Youth Hostel Organisation, which currently manages the island’s only hostel, has posted a message on its website declaring the Haut de la Garenne branch shut for a year because of the ongoing police investigation.
